Brief Summary
The purpose of this study is to determine the prevalence of esophageal pathology in patients with voice disorders. In addition, , the intra- and interdisciplinary variability regarding the identificat...

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ion
- Inclusion criteria:
- Study participants include persons 18 years and older
- Patients presenting to the Vanderbilt Voice Center and complaining of throat symptoms. These include hoarseness, throat clearing/pain/burning, heartburn, globus sensation, and acidic/sour taste.
- New and return patients will be included.
- Exclusion criteria:
- Participants who are unwilling to undergo the study
- Patients who have had prior esophagoscopy
- Those who do not sign the consent
- Pregnant women.
